The "American Horror Story" franchise has been thriving for the past few years. With the successful "Murder House" and the not-so-successful "Roanoke" fans of the show have grown to love some of the iconic characters that were given to us throughout the series. These characters are played by our staple actors like Evan Peters and Sarah Paulson, while other have made special appearances and may even become a part of the steady cast themselves.

Here are 22 "American Horror Story" characters ranked from lowest to highest in popularity, see if yours made the cut:

22. Harrison Wilton (Billy Eichner) - "Cult"

21. The Countess (Lady GaGa) - "Hotel"

Queen of all her little monsters, GaGa's debut in "Hotel" couldn't have been more perfect for her.

20. Liz Taylor (Denis O'Hare) - "Hotel"

Denis O'Hare in drag...there is nothing this man won't do for this show.

19. Dr. Oliver Thredson (Zachary Quinto) - "Asylum"

His mommy issues were a little creepy, but he was still a pretty good character.

18. Misty Day (Lily Rabe) - "Coven"

This Lily Rabe character was so innocent and obsessed with Stevie Nicks, how could you not love her?

17. Winter Anderson (Billie Lourd) - "Cult"

Winter is slowly winning fans over as "Cult" goes on. She's the babysitter no child should have, but we wouldn't have her any other way.

16. Moira O'Hara (Alexandra Breckinridge/Frances Conroy) - "Murder House"

It's always the redheads, isn't it?

15. Kit Walker (Evan Peters) - "Asylum"

Poor Kit went through so much crap that he didn't deserve...but we did get to see his butt.

14. Sister Mary Eunice (Lily Rabe) - "Asylum"

Lily Rabe's best role by far. Classic case of good girl gone bad...well maybe not.

13. Elsa Mars (Jessica Lange) - "Freak Show"

At times we hated Elsa and at times we felt bad for her, but all in all, she loved her monsters.

12. Queenie (Gabourey Sidibe) - "Coven"

Queenie was the girl that I wish was in high school: sassy and confident in all that she does.

11. Tate Langdon (Evan Peters) - "Murder House"

If his "Don't you die on me" line didn't hit you in the feels, you're not human.

10. Lana Winters (Sarah Paulson) - "Asylum"

Lana was so incredibly strong which made her character stand out. She's the woman we need in today's society for sure.

9. Dandy Mott (Flinn Wittrock) - "Freak Show"

Honestly, it was hard not to love Dandy, even though he was a psychotic spoiled brat.

8. Kai Anderson (Evan Peters) - "Cult"

Kai is terrifyingly persuasive and has some hate in him, but he's becoming a "Cult" favorite.

7. Delphine LaLaurie (Kathy Bates) - "Coven"

Definitely a character that we loved to hate. She did have her funny moments too.

6. The Butcher (Kathy Bates) - "Roanoke"

Completely insane and terrifying, the Butcher was probably the best character in "Roanoke."

5. Violet Harmon (Taissa Farmiga) - "Murder House"

Violet knew what was up the moment they arrived at the Murder House. She was angsty, but with good reason.

4. Madison Montgomery (Emma Roberts) - "Coven"

Madison is the Regina George of "American Horror Story," which is all the more reason to love her. She will also remain on Twitter feeds for years to come in gif-form.

3. Twisty the Clown (John Caroll Lynch) - "Freak Show"

Everyone was rooting for Twisty, even when he was senselessly stabbing people to death. So misunderstood.

2. Marie Laveau (Angela Bassett) - "Coven"

Marie is not someone to be messed with. She's definitely the fiercest of them all. Yas queen.

1. Fiona Goode (Jessica Lange) - "Coven"

The queen of "American Horror Story" is without a doubt Jessica Lange and she owned this role. Fiona was selfish and borderline evil, but we loved her all the same.
